Output fe8338e81d1d38780089c3dd6a73cdfba9fa93a2785e27b1a93709a37b8d77da:7

value
29578566
script pubkey
OP_0 OP_PUSHBYTES_32 be9befdcd0b4a2db4b181309a8a9d4a1de680e48f8be85396189c67bc26be70b
address
bc1qh6d7lhxskj3dkjcczvy632w5580xsrjglzlg2wtp38r8hsntuu9sj6ndx4
transaction
fe8338e81d1d38780089c3dd6a73cdfba9fa93a2785e27b1a93709a37b8d77da
spent
true